WebNov 24, 2024 · An increase in the standard Value Added Tax (“VAT”) rate from 12.5% to 15%. The introduction of a 35% marginal income tax rate for individuals and revision of the upper limits for vehicle benefits. Reduction the E-levy rate from 1.5% to 1% of transaction value and removal of daily non-taxable threshold. WebThe 12.5% VAT shall be computed on the value of the taxable supply inclusive of NHIL, GETFund Levy and COVID-19 Levy. In the case of the Flat Rate, the CG, per the examples cited, requires that the Levy and VAT be applied on the tax exclusive value of the supplies.
